## Neighborhood Overview


### Overview of Bath Beach
**Bath Beach** is the bridge between Bensonhurst and Dyker Heights. A waterfront neighborhood overlooking Gravesend Bay, it is quiet, residential, and steeped in history. For buyers seeking **Bath Beach Brooklyn real estate**, it offers water views and solid housing stock. Living in **Bath Beach** is breezy. You can walk along the bay promenade and watch the ships go by. As a **Brooklyn NYC neighborhood**, it is a hidden gem for value.


### Real Estate & Housing Market
The market for **homes for sale in Bath Beach** includes semi-detached brick 2-family homes and low-rise condos. Prices are generally more affordable than neighboring Bensonhurst or Dyker Heights.


### Lifestyle & Community
The lifestyle in **Bath Beach** is relaxed. 86th Street is the main shopping drag. The community is diverse, with growing Asian, Hispanic, and Russian populations joining the long-standing Italian community.


### Transportation & Accessibility
**Bath Beach** is served by the D train. The express run to Manhattan is efficient. The Belt Parkway runs along the waterfront, offering easy driving access.


### Parks, Schools & Amenities
**Bath Beach Park** and the shorefront promenade are the main attractions. Amenities: Big-box stores like BJ's Wholesale Club are located nearby along the waterfront.


### Who This Neighborhood Is Best For
Bath Beach is best for families, retirees, and those seeking water views on a budget.

BUYER FAQ
## Bath Beach Frequently Asked Questions

Is there a beach?
Not for swimming, but there is a promenade along the water with great views of the Verrazzano Bridge.


Is it safe?
Yes, very safe.


How is the commute?
The D train gets you to Midtown in about 45 minutes.


Are the schools good?
Yes, there are solid public elementary schools in the area.


Is it windy?
Yes, right off the bay it can get very breezy in winter!
